Bachelor of Science in Agriculture [B.Sc.(Agr.)]

Agronomy (AGRO)

Departments of Plant Agriculture, and Land Resource Science

Semester 1

AGR*1100 [0.50] Introduction to the Agrifood Systems
BIOL*1030 [0.50] Biology I
CHEM*1040 [0.50] General Chemistry I
ECON*1050 [0.50] Introductory Microeconomics
MATH*1080 [0.50] Elements of Calculus I

Semester 2

AGR*1250 [0.50] Agrifood System Trends & Issues
BIOL*1040 [0.50] Biology II
CHEM*1050 [0.50] General Chemistry II
ENGL*1200 [0.50] Reading the Contemporary World
0.50 electives

Semester 3

AGR*2320 [0.50] Soils in Agroecosystems
AGR*2350 [0.50] Animal Production Systems and Industry
AGR*2400 [0.50] Economics of the Canadian Food System
AGR*2470 [0.50] Introduction to Plant Agriculture
BOT*2100 [0.50] Life Strategies of Plants

Semester 4

BIOC*2580 [0.50] Introductory Biochemistry
MBG*2000 [0.50] Introductory Genetics
STAT*2040 [0.50] Statistics I
1.00 electives or restricted electives

Semester 5

FOOD*3070 [0.50] Introduction to Food Processing
MBG*3100 [0.50] Plant Genetics
PBIO*3110 [0.50] Crop Physiology
SOIL*3080 [0.50] Soil and Water Conservation
0.50 electives or restricted electives

Semester 6

EDRD*3400 [0.50] Sustainable Rural Communities
2.00 electives or restricted electives

Semester 7 & 8

Students must choose either Option A or B in Semester 7 and 8

Option A:
Semester 7
CROP*4240 [0.50] Weed Science
SOIL*4090 [0.50] Soil Management
1.50 electives or restricted electives
Semester 8
AGR*4500 [0.50] Agrifood Industry Problem-Solving
CROP*4220 [0.50] Cropping Systems
1.50 electives or restricted electives

Option B
Semester 7
AGR*4450 [1.00] Research Project in Agriculture I
CROP*4240 [0.50] Weed Science
SOIL*4090 [0.50] Soil Management
0.50 electives or restricted electives
Semester 8
AGR*4460 [1.00] Research Project in Agriculture II
CROP*4220 [0.50] Cropping Systems
1.00 electives or restricted electives

Restricted Electives

  1. Select two of the following Agronomy major electives:

    CROP*3300 [0.50] Grain Crops
    CROP*3310 [0.50] Protein and Oilseed Crops
    CROP*3340 [0.50] Managed Grasslands
  2. A minimum of 7.00 credits must be at the 3000 level or higher, of which 5.00 credits must be in agricultural science and of which 3.50 credits must be at the 4000 level. Refer to Program Counsellor for list of agricultural science courses.

  3. A humanities or social science course (0.50 credits) at the 2000 level or above from the College of Arts or College of Social and Applied Human Sciences.
